Ltd.</publisher-name></publisher></journal-meta><article-meta><article-id pub-id-type="doi">10.26689/jcer.v9i8.12049</article-id><article-categories><subj-group subj-group-type="heading"><subject>Article</subject></subj-group></article-categories><title>A Study on Strategies for Integrating Dalcroze Eurhythmics into Elementary Dance Education</title><url>https://artdesignp.com/journal/JCER/9/8/10.26689/jcer.v9i8.12049</url><author>ZhouHongxia</author><pub-date pub-type="publication-year"><year>2025</year></pub-date><volume>9</volume><issue>8</issue><history><date date-type="pub"><published-time>2025-09-17</published-time></date></history><abstract>This study investigates effective methods for integrating Dalcroze Eurhythmics into elementary dance education, highlighting its necessity in fostering children’s holistic development and enriching teaching content. The research proposes strategies such as incorporating Eurhythmics elements into dance choreography and rhythm training, and utilizing game-based teaching to spark student interest and enhance physical coordination and artistic expression. Despite challenges like insufficient teacher expertise and inadequate teaching resources, this paper suggests solutions including strengthening teacher training, optimizing resource allocation, and integrating technology. Future research should focus on long-term impact assessment and refining evaluation systems to promote the standardized development of Eurhythmics in elementary dance education.</abstract><keywords/></article-meta></front><body/><back><ref-list><ref id="B1" content-type="article"><label>1</label><element-citation publication-type="journal"><p>Ministry of Education of the People’s Republic of China, 2022, Art Curriculum Standards for Compulsory Education, Beijing: Beijing Normal University Publishing Group.</p><pub-id pub-id-type="doi"/></element-citation></ref><ref id="B2" content-type="article"><label>2</label><element-citation publication-type="journal"><p>Yang L, Cai J, 2011, Dalcroze Music Education Theory and Practice, Shanghai Education Press, 8.</p><pub-id pub-id-type="doi"/></element-citation></ref><ref id="B3" content-type="article"><label>3</label><element-citation publication-type="journal"><p>Jaques-Dalcroze E, 2021, The Dalcroze Method: Eurhythmics, Culture and Art Publishing House, Preface, 3.</p><pub-id pub-id-type="doi"/></element-citation></ref><ref id="B4" content-type="article"><label>4</label><element-citation publication-type="journal"><p>Chen Y, 2021, Discussion on the application of dance rhythm teaching in primary school music classrooms, Teacher, 2021(34): 53–54.</p><pub-id pub-id-type="doi"/></element-citation></ref><ref id="B5" content-type="article"><label>5</label><element-citation publication-type="journal"><p>Ismail M, Chiat L, Ying L, 2023, An active learning study: Mastering music coordination skills through Kompang and Dalcroze Eurhythmics among primary students, International Journal of Instruction, 16(1): 191–203.</p><pub-id pub-id-type="doi"/></element-citation></ref><ref id="B6" content-type="article"><label>6</label><element-citation publication-type="journal"><p>Yang L, Cai J, 2011, Dalcroze Music Education Theory and Practice, Shanghai Education Press, 43.</p><pub-id pub-id-type="doi"/></element-citation></ref><ref id="B7" content-type="article"><label>7</label><element-citation publication-type="journal"><p>Wang X, 2014, Educational dance for the cultivation of a sound personality, An analysis of Kunimasa Yoshimi’s educational dance philosophy, Journal of Zhejiang Vocational Academy of Art, 12(3): 6.</p><pub-id pub-id-type="doi"/></element-citation></ref><ref id="B8" content-type="article"><label>8</label><element-citation publication-type="journal"><p>Schiller F, 2003, On the Aesthetic Education of Man, Shanghai People’s Publishing House, 119.</p><pub-id pub-id-type="doi"/></element-citation></ref></ref-list></back></article>
